Amlodipine, an antihypertensive drug, and diclofenac, an anti inflammatory drug, may generally be combined, particularly in elderly patients; therefore, the potential for their interaction is high. We aim to determine if amlodipine interferes with the antimigratory effect of diclofenac. For this, male spontaneously hypertensive rats (SHRs) were treated with either diclofenac (1 mg.kg(-1).d(-1), 15 d) alone or combined with amlodipine (10 mg.kg(-1).d(-1), 15 d). Leukocyte rolling, adherence, and migration were studied by intravital microscopy. Diclofenac did not change (180.0 +/- 2.3), whereas amlodipine combined (163.4 +/- 5.1) or not (156.3 +/- 4.3) with diclofienac reduced the blood pressure (BP) levels in SHR (183.1 +/- 4.4). Diclofenac and amlodipine reduced leukocyte adherence, migration, and ICAM-I expression, whereas only diclofenac reduced rolling leukocytes as well. Combined with amlodipine, the effect of the diclofenac was reduced. Neither treatment tested increased the venular shear rate or modified the venular diameters, number of circulating leukocytes, P-selectin, PECAM-1, L-selectin, or CD-18 expressions. No difference could be found in plasma concentrations of both drugs given alone or in association. In conclusion, amlodipine reduces leukocyte migration in SHR, reducing endothelial cell ICAM-1 expression. Amlodipine reduces the effect of the diclofenac, possibly by the same mechanism. A pharmacokinetic interaction as well as an effect on the other adhesion molecules tested could be discarded.

Disturbances in the regulation of cytosolic calcium (Ca(2+)) concentration play a key role in the vascular dysfunction associated with arterial hypertension. Stromal interaction molecules (STIMs) and Orai proteins represent a novel mechanism to control store-operated Ca(2+) entry. Although STIMs act as Ca(2+) sensors for the intracellular Ca(2+) stores, Orai is the putative pore-forming component of Ca(2+) release-activated Ca(2+) channels at the plasma membrane. We hypothesized that augmented activation of Ca(2+) release-activated Ca(2+)/Orai-1, through enhanced activity of STIM-1, plays a role in increased basal tonus and vascular reactivity in hypertensive animals. Endothelium-denuded aortic rings from Wistar-Kyoto and stroke-prone spontaneously hypertensive rats were used to evaluate contractions because of Ca(2+) influx. Depletion of intracellular Ca(2+) stores, which induces Ca(2+) release-activated Ca(2+) activation, was performed by placing arteries in Ca(2+) free-EGTA buffer. The addition of the Ca(2+) regular buffer produced greater contractions in aortas from stroke-prone spontaneously hypertensive rats versus Wistar-Kyoto rats. Thapsigargin (10 mu mol/L), an inhibitor of the sarcoplasmic reticulum Ca(2+) ATPase, further increased these contractions, especially in stroke-prone spontaneously hypertensive rat aorta. Addition of the Ca(2+) release-activated Ca(2+) channel inhibitors 2-aminoethoxydiphenyl borate (100 mu mol/L) or gadolinium (100 mu mol/L), as well as neutralizing antibodies to STIM-1 or Orai-1, abolished thapsigargin-increased contraction and the differences in spontaneous tone between the groups. Expression of Orai-1 and STIM-1 proteins was increased in aorta from stroke-prone spontaneously hypertensive rats when compared with Wistar-Kyoto rats. These results support the hypothesis that both Orai-1 and STIM-1 contribute to abnormal vascular function in hypertension. Augmented activation of STIM-1/Orai-1 may represent the mechanism that leads to impaired control of intracellular Ca(2+) levels in hypertension. (Hypertension. 2009; 53[part 2]: 409-416.)

Recent evidence suggests that angiotensin II (Ang II) upregulates phosphodiesterase (PDE) 1A expression. We hypothesized that Ang II augmented PDE1 activation, decreasing the bioavailability of cyclic guanosine 3` 5`-monophosphate (cGMP), and contributing to increased vascular contractility. Male Sprague-Dawley rats received mini-osmotic pumps with Ang II (60 ng.min(-1)) or saline for 14 days. Phenylephrine (PE)-induced contractions were increased in aorta (E(max)168%+/- 8% vs 136%+/- 4%) and small mesenteric arteries (SMA; E(max)170%+/- 6% vs 143%+/- 3%) from Ang II-infused rats compared to control. PDE1 inhibition with vinpocetine (10 mu mol/L) reduced PE-induced contraction in aortas from Ang II rats (E(max)94%+/- 12%) but not in controls (154%+/- 7%). Vinpocetine decreased the sensitivity to PE in SMA from Ang II rats compared to vehicle (-log of half maximal effective concentration 5.1 +/- 0.1 vs 5.9 +/- 0.06), but not in controls (6.0 +/- 0.03 vs 6.1 +/- 0.04). Sildenafil (10 mu mol/L), a PDE5 inhibitor, reduced PE-induced maximal contraction similarly in Ang II and control rats. Arteries were contracted with PE (1 mu mol/L), and concentration-dependent relaxation to vinpocetine and sildenafil was evaluated. Aortas from Ang II rats displayed increased relaxation to vinpocetine compared to control (E(max)82%+/- 12% vs 445 +/- 5%). SMA from Ang II rats showed greater sensitivity during vinpocetine-induced relaxation compared to control (-log of half maximal effective concentration 6.1 +/- 0.3 vs 5.3 +/- 0.1). No differences in sildenafil-induced relaxation were observed. PDE1A and PDE1C expressions in aorta and PDE1A expression in SMA were increased in Ang II rats. cGMP production, which is decreased in arteries from Ang II rats, was restored after PDE1 blockade. We conclude that PDE1 activation reduces cGMP bioavailability in arteries from Ang II, contributing to increased contractile responsiveness. (Hypertension. 2011;57[part 2]:655-663.)

Objectives The present study aimed to assess the effect of the specific dipeptidyl peptidase IV (DPPIV) inhibitor sitagliptin on blood pressure and renal function in young prehypertensive (5-week-old) and adult spontaneously hypertensive rats (SHRs; 14-week-old). Methods Sitagliptin (40 mg/kg twice daily) was given by oral gavage to young (Y-SHR + IDPPIV) and adult (A-SHR R IDPPIV) SHRs for 8 days. Kidney function was assessed daily and compared with age-matched vehicle-treated SHR (Y-SHR and A-SHR) and with normotensive Wistar-Kyoto rats (Y-WKY and A-WKY). Arterial blood pressure was measured in these animals at the end of the experimental protocol. Additionally, Na(+)/H(+) exchanger isoform 3 (NHE3) function and expression in microvilli membrane vesicles were assessed in young animals. Results Mean arterial blood pressure of Y-SHR + IDPPIV was significantly lower than that of Y-SHR (104 +/- 3 vs. 123 +/- 5 mmHg, P < 0.01) and was similar to Y-WKY (94 +/- 4 mmHg, P > 0.05). Compared to Y-SHR, Y-SHR + IDPPIV exhibited enhanced cumulative urinary flow and sodium excretion and decreased NHE3 activity and expression in proximal tubule microvilli. In the A-SHR, sitagliptin treatment had no significant effect on either renal function or arterial blood pressure. Conclusion Our data suggest that DPPIV inhibition attenuates blood pressure rising in young prehypertensive SHRs, partially by inhibiting NHE3 activity in renal proximal tubule. The polymorphisms of endothelial nitric oxide synthase (eNOS) are associated with reduced eNOS activity. Aerobic exercise training (AEX) may influence resting nitric oxide (NO) production, oxidative stress and blood pressure. The purpose of this study was to investigate the effect of AEX on the relationship among blood pressure, eNOS gene polymorphism and oxidative stress in pre-hypertensive older people. 118 pre-hypertensive subjects (59 +/- A 6 years) had blood samples collected after a 12 h overnight fast for assessing plasma NO metabolites (NOx) assays, thiobarbituric acid reactive substances (T-BARS) and superoxide dismutase activity (ecSOD). eNOS polymorphism (T-786C and G-894T) was done by standard PCR methods. All people were divided according to the genotype results (G1: TT/GG, G2: TT/GT + TT, G3: TC + CC/GG, G4: TC + CC/GT + TT). All parameters were measured before and after 6 months of AEX (70% of VO(2 max)). At baseline, no difference was found in systolic and diastolic blood pressure, ecSOD and T-BARS activity. Plasma NOx levels were significantly different between G1 (19 +/- A 1 mu M) and G4 (14.2 +/- A 0.6 mu M) and between G2 (20.1 +/- A 1.7 mu M) and G4 (14.2 +/- A 0.6 mu M). Therefore, reduced NOx concentration in G4 group occurred only when the polymorphisms were associated, suggesting that these results are more related to genetic factors than NO-scavenging effect. After AEX, the G4 increased NOx values (17.2 +/- A 1.2 mu M) and decreased blood pressure. G1, G3 and G4 decreased T-BARS levels. These results suggest the AEX can modulate the NOx concentration, eNOS activity and the relationship among eNOS gene polymorphism, oxidative stress and blood pressure especially in C (T-786C) and T (G-894T) allele carriers.

The P2Y(12) receptor antagonist clopidogrel blocks platelet aggregation, improves systemic endothelial nitric oxide bioavailability and has anti-inflammatory effects. Since P2Y(12) receptors have been identified in the vasculature, we hypothesized that clopidogrel ameliorates Angll (angiotensin II)-induced vascular functional changes by blockade of P2Y(12) receptors in the vasculature. Male Sprague Dawley rats were infused with Angll (60 ng/min) or vehicle for 14 days. The animals were treated with clopidogrel (10 mg . kg(-1) of body weight . day(-1)) or vehicle. Vascular reactivity was evaluated in second-order mesenteric arteries. Clopidogrel treatment did not change systolic blood pressure [(mmHg) control-vehicle, 117 +/- 7.1 versus control-clopidogrel, 125 +/- 4.2; Angll vehicle, 197 +/- 10.7 versus Angll clopidogrel, 198 +/- 5.2], but it normalized increased phenylephrine-induced vascular contractions [(%KCI) vehicle-treated, 182.2 +/- 18% versus clopidogrel, 133 +/- 14%), as well as impaired vasodilation to acetylcholine [(%) vehicle-treated, 71.7 +/- 2.2 versus clopidogrel, 85.3 +/- 2.8) in Angll-treated animals. Vascular expression of P2Y(12) receptor was determined by Western blot. Pharmacological characterization of vascular P2Y(12) was performed with the P2Y(12) agonist 2-MeS-ADP [2-(methylthio) adenosine 5`-trihydrogen diphosphate trisodium]. Although 2-MeS-ADP induced endothelium-dependent relaxation [(Emax %) = 71 +/- 12%) as well as contractile vascular responses (Emax % = 83 +/- 12%), these actions are not mediated by P2Y(12) receptor activation. 2-MeS-ADP produced similar vascular responses in control and Angll rats. These results indicate potential effects of clopidogrel, such as improvement of hypertension-related vascular functional changes that are not associated with direct actions of clopidogrel in the vasculature, supporting the concept that activated platelets contribute to endothelial dysfunction, possibly via impaired nitric oxide bioavailability.

In hypertension, left ventricular (LV) hypertrophy develops as an adaptive mechanism to compensate for increased afterload and thus preserve systolic function. Associated structural changes such as microvascular disease might potentially interfere with this mechanism, producing pathological hypertrophy. A poorer outcome is expected to occur when LV function is put in jeopardy by impaired coronary reserve. The aim of this study was to evaluate the role of coronary reserve in the long-term outcome of patients with hypertensive dilated cardiomyopathy. Between 1996 and 2000, 45 patients, 30 of them male, with 52 +/- 11 years and LV fractional shortening <30% were enrolled and followed until 2006. Coronary flow velocity reserve was assessed by transesophageal Doppler of the left anterior descending coronary artery. Sixteen patients showed >= 10% improvement in LV fractional shortening after 17 +/- 6 months. Coronary reserve was the only variable independently related to this improvement. Total mortality was 38% in 10 years. The Cox model identified coronary reserve (hazard ratio = 0.814; 95% CI = 0.72-0.92), LV mass, low diastolic blood pressure, and male gender as independent predictors of mortality. In hypertensive dilated cardiomyopathy, coronary reserve impairment adversely affects survival, possibly by interfering with the improvement of LV dysfunction. J Am Soc Hypertens 2010;4(1):14-21. BACKGROUND Oxidized lipoproteins and antioxidized low-density lipoprotein (anti-oxLDL) antibodies (Abs) have been detected in plasma in response to blood pressure (BP) elevation, suggesting the participation of the adaptive immune system. Therefore, treatment of hypertension may act on the immune response by decreasing oxidation stimuli. However, this issue has not been addressed. Thus, we have here analyzed anti-oxLDL Abs in untreated (naive) hypertensive patients shortly after initiation of anti hypertensive therapeutic regimens. METHODS Titers of anti-oxLDL Abs were measured in subjects with recently diagnosed hypertension on stage 1 (n = 94), in primary prevention of coronary disease, with no other risk factors, and naive of anti hypertensive medication at entry. Subjects were randomly assigned to receive perindopril, hydrochlorothiazide (HCTZ), or indapamide (INDA) for 12 weeks, with additional perindopril if necessary to achieve BP control. Abs against copper-oxidized LDL were measured by enzyme-linked immunosorbent assay. RESULTS Twelve-week antihypertensive treatment reduced both office-based and 24-h ambulatory BP measurements (P < 0.0005). The decrease in BP was accompanied by reduction in thiobarbituric acid-reactive substances (TBARS) (P < 0.05), increase in anti-oxLDL Ab titers (P < 0.005), and improvement in flow-mediated dilation (FMD) (P < 0.0005), independently of treatment. Although BP was reduced, we observed favorable changes in anti-oxLDL titers and FMD. CONCLUSIONS We observed that anti-oxLDL Ab titers increase after antihypertensive therapy in primary prevention when achieving BP targets. Our results are in agreement with the concept that propensity to oxidation is increased by essential hypertension and anti-oxLDL Abs may be protective and potential biomarkers for the follow-up of hypertension treatment.

Adenosine Is known to modulate neuronal activity within the nucleus tractus solitarius (NTS). The modulatory effect of adenosine A, receptors (A(1R)) on alpha(2)-adrenoceptors (Adr(2R)) was evaluated using quantitative radioautography within NTS subnuclei and using neuronal culture of normotensive (WKY) and spontaneously hypertensive rats (SHR). Radioautography was used in a saturation experiment to measure Adr2R binding parameters (B(max), K(d)) In the presence of 3 different concentrations of N(6)-cyclopentyladenosine (CPA), an A(1R) agonist. Neuronal culture confirmed our radioautographic results. [(3)H]RX821002, an Adr(2R) antagonist, was used as a ligand for both approaches. The dorsomedial/dorsolateral subnucleus of WKY showed an increase in B(max) values (21%) Induced by 10 nmol/L of CPA. However, the subpostremal subnucleus showed a decrease in Kd values (24%) induced by 10 nmol/L of CPA. SHR showed the same pattern of changes as WKY within the same subnuclei; however, the modulatory effect of CPA was induced by I nmol/L (increased B(max), 17%; decreased K(d), 26%). Cell culture confirmed these results, because 10(-5) and 10(-7) mol/L of CPA promoted an Increase in [3H]RX821002 binding of WKY (53%) and SHR cells (48%), respectively. DPCPX, an AIR antagonist, was used to block the modulatory effect promoted by CPA with respect to Adr2R binding. In conclusion, our study shows for the first time an interaction between A(1R) that increases the binding of Adr2R within specific subnuclei of the NTS. This may be important In understanding the complex autonomic response induced by adenosine within the NTS. In addition, changes in interactions between receptors might be relevant to understanding the development of hypertension. (Hypertens Res 2008; 31: 2177-2186)

Bj-BPP-10c is a bioactive proline-rich decapeptide, part of the C-type natriuretic peptide precursor, expressed in the brain and in the venom gland of Bothrops jararaca. We recently showed that Bj-BPP-10c displays a strong, sustained anti-hypertensive effect in spontaneous hypertensive rats (SHR), without causing any effect in normotensive rats, by a pharmacological effect independent of angiotensin-converting enzyme inhibition. Therefore, we hypothesized that another mechanism should be involved in the peptide activity. Here we used affinity chromatography to search for kidney cytosolic proteins with affinity for Bj-BPP-10c and demonstrate that argininosuccinate synthetase (AsS) is the major protein binding to the peptide. More importantly, this interaction activates the catalytic activity of AsS in a dose-dependent manner. AsS is recognized as an important player of the citrulline-NO cycle that represents a potential limiting step in NO synthesis. Accordingly, the functional interaction of Bj-BPP-10c and AsS was evidenced by the following effects promoted by the peptide: (i) increase of NO metabolite production in human umbilical vein endothelial cell culture and of arginine in human embryonic kidney cells and (ii) increase of arginine plasma concentration in SHR. Moreover, alpha-methyl-DL-aspartic acid, a specific AsS inhibitor, significantly reduced the anti-hypertensive activity of Bj-BPP-10c in SHR. Taken together, these results suggest that AsS plays a role in the anti-hypertensive action of Bj-BPP-10c. Therefore, we propose the activation of AsS as a new mechanism for the anti-hypertensive effect of Bj-BPP-10c in SHR and AsS as a novel target for the therapy of hypertension-related diseases.

Background: The number of childbearing adolescents in Vietnam is relatively low but they are more prone to experience adverse outcome than adult women. Reports of increasing rates of abortion and prevalence of STIs including HIV among youth indicate a need to improve services and counselling for these groups. Midwives are key persons in the promotion of young people’s sexual and reproductive health in Vietnam. Aim: The overall aim of this thesis is to describe the prevalence and outcome of adolescent pregnancies in Vietnam (I), to explore the social context and health care seeking behavior of pregnant adolescents (II), as well as to explore the perspectives of health care providers and midwifery students regarding adolescent sexuality and reproductive health service needs (III, IV). Methods: The studies were conducted from 2002 to 2005, combining qualitative and quantitative research methods. A population based prospective survey was used to estimate rates and outcomes of adolescent pregnancies (I). Pregnant and newly delivered adolescents’ experiences of childbearing and their encounters with health care providers were studied using qualitative interviews (II). Health care providers’ perspective on adolescent sexual and reproductive health (ASRH) and views on how to improve the quality of abortion care was explored in focus group discussions (FGD). The values and attitudes of midwifery students about ASRH were investigated using questionnaires and interviews (IV). Descriptive statistics was used to analyse quantitative data (I, IV) and content analysis were applied for qualitative data (II, III, and IV). Findings: Adolescent birth rate was similar to previously reported in Vietnam but lower when compared to other Asian countries. The incidence of stillborn among adolescents was higher than for women in higher reproductive ages. The proportion of preterm deliveries was 20 % of all births, higher than previous findings from Vietnam. About 2 % of the deliveries were home deliveries, more common among women with low education, belonging to ethnic minority and/or living in mountainous areas (I). Ambivalence facing motherhood, pride and happiness but also worries and lack of self-confidence emerged as themes from the interviews; and experience of ‘being in the hands of others’ in a positive, caring sense but also in a sense of subordination in relation to husband, family and health care providers (II). Health care providers at abortion clinics and midwifery students generally disapproved of pre-marital sex, but had a pragmatic view on the need for contraceptive services and counselling to reduce the burden of unwanted pregnancies and abortions for young women. Providers and midwifery students expressed a need for training on ASRH issues (III, IV). Conclusion: Cultural norms and gender inequity make pregnant adolescent women in Vietnam vulnerable to sexual and reproductive health risks. Health care providers experience ethical dilemmas while counselling unmarried adolescents who come for abortion and this has a negative impact on the quality of care. Integrated ASRH in education and training programmes for health care providers, including midwives, as well as continued in-service training on these issues are suggested to improve reproductive health care services in Vietnam.

Background: In Sweden, midwives play prominent supportive role in antenatal care by counselling and promoting healthy lifestyles. This study aimed to explore how Swedish midwives experience the counselling of pregnant women on physical activity, specifically focusing on facilitators and barriers during pregnancy. Also, addressing whether the midwives perceive that their own lifestyle and body shape may influence the content of the counselling they provide. Methods: Eight focus group discussions (FGD) were conducted with 41 midwives working in antenatal care clinics in different parts of Sweden between September 2013 and January 2014. Purposive sampling was applied to ensure a variation in age, work experience, and geographical location. The FGD were digitally recorded, transcribed verbatim, and analyzed using manifest and latent content analysis. Results: The main theme- "An on-going individual adjustment" was built on three categories: "Counselling as a challenge"; "Counselling as walking the thin ice" and "Counselling as an opportunity" reflecting the midwives on-going need to adjust their counselling depending on each woman's specific situation. Furthermore, counselling pregnant women on physical activity was experienced as complex and ambiguous, presenting challenges as well as opportunities. When midwives challenged barriers to physical activity, they risked being rejected by the pregnant women. Despite risking rejection, the midwives tried to promote increased physical activity based on their assessment of individual needs of the pregnant woman. Some participants felt that their own lifestyle and body shape might negatively influence the counselling; however, the majority of participants did not agree with this perspective. Conclusions: Counselling on physical activity during pregnancy may be a challenging task for midwives, characterized by on-going adjustments based on a pregnant woman's individual needs. Midwives strive to find individual solutions to encourage physical activity. However, to improve their counselling, midwives may benefit from further training, also organizational and financial barriers need to be addressed. Such efforts might result in improved opportunities to further support pregnant women's motivation for performance of physical activity.

The preeclampsia is a disease that evolves to high death rate for the mother and for the fetus. The incidence of this disease in the world is variable and there are no data of this disturb in the Brazilian population. This paper had the objective to determine the incidence and risk factors for development of hypertensive disorders of pregnancy in a neighborhood in Natal, RN, Brazil, taking place a prospective study, cohort type, with the objective of evaluating the entire pregnancy of 242 women that got pregnant between 2004-2007. The incidence of hypertensive disorders was of 17%, while the incidence of preeclampsia was of 13.8%. The age average of women that developed the hypertensive disorders was of 27.4 years (SD±.9), whilst those that developed preeclampsia was of 26.6 (SD ±7.8) years and the normotensive was of 23.9 (SD±5.8) (p=0.002). It is noted a significant increase of the hypertensive disorder with age (p=0.0265). The gestational age for those who developed preeclampsia was lower than the women that developed normotensive pregnancy (p=0.0002). The body mass index (BMI) of the group of women that developed the hypertensive disorder was of 25.8 (SD±3.9), significantly higher than the group of normotensive women with 23.5 (SD±3.7) (p=0.02). The levels of triglycerides and cholesterol tended to be higher on women with preeclampsia than on normotensive, p=0.0502 and p=0.0566, respectively. Six (6) women presented with severe preeclampsia and one (1) developed HELLP Syndrome. The resolution of the pregnancy was performed by cesarean section in 70% of women that developed hypertensive disorders, whilst the normotensive was of 23.6% (p<0.0001). A subgroup of the studied subjects was reassessed one year after labor, revealing that 50% of the patients were still hypertensive. There were no larger complications nor mother death during labor. The incidence of hypertensive disorders are above the levels noted in other studies and 30% of the women were within the poles of greater risk for the hypertensive disorders; the elevated BMI in the beginning of the pregnancy is a risk factor for hypertensive disorder. The risk of severe complication in preeclampsia is high, with imminence of eclampsia occurring in 20.1% of women who developed hypertensive disorder of pregnancy. The adequate prenatal care and the opportune labor assistance may minimize the complications of the pregnancy hypertension and avoid mother death, although the risk of women remaining hypertensive is elevated

The general aim of the research was to comprehend the Social Representations constructed by the man in the face of his companion s risk pregnancy caused by hypertensive syndromes. The study is of exploratory and descriptive character in a qualitative approach developed at two public maternity hospitals, both located in Natal-RN, with 65 men whose wives had undergone high-risk pregnancy. The project was submitted to the Ethics on Research Committee of the Federal University of Rio Grande do Norte, Brazil (CEP-UFRN), with favorable report no. 81/07. For data collection, the following multimethods were employed: a word free association test; a projective test for registering mental images; and a semistructured interview schedule. The speech contents were analyzed in accordance with the Theory of Social Representations and complemented by the Central Nucleus Theory. The discussion of the results was grounded on literary findings of the companion s participation in pregnancy as well as in risk pregnancy associated with hypertensive syndromes. The data showed fear as representation s central nucleus, while recollections of that feeling referred to death of both companion and child in addition to fear of the unknown. The categories preoccupation and carefulness, other feelings, and clinical picture of the disease represented components of the peripheral nucleus. The results concerning mental images followed the same category criteria of the word free association test fear, other feelings, preoccupation, carefulness, and clinical picture of the disease. After being processed in accordance with the principles of content analysis, the statements originated three thematic unities: fear and insecurity in the presence of the companion s risk pregnancy; attitudes of carefulness to the risk pregnancy of the partner; and humanized assistance during the companion s risk pregnancy. Considering the results, the conclusion is that the partner s risk pregnancy caused by hypertensive syndromes represents, for the man, feelings of fear, preoccupation, insecurity, lack of acceptance and information, as well as attitudes of carefulness. The results reveal necessity of reorganizing the obstetric assistance with an eye to including the man as participant in the reproductive process. That demands extension of humanized carefulness to the companion with a view to make him an active coadjutor in the assistance of high-risk pregnant

OBJECTIVE: Preeclampsia is a disease that can lead to a high maternal and infant morbidity. Worldwide, the incidence of this disease is highly variable and there is no data on this disorder in the Brazilian population. This study aimed at determining incidence and risk factors in the hypertensive disorders during pregnancy in a neighborhood of Natal, in addition to observing the evolution of these disorders one year and five years after delivery. METHODS: Prospective cohort study to assess the outcome of pregnancies of 242 women who became pregnant between 2004-2007 in the neighborhood of Bom Pastor in the city of Natal, state of RN, Brazil. Five years after delivery, there was an active search of thirty-nine (39) women who became pregnant and had a hypertensive disorder during pregnancy and/or pré-eclâmpsia, out of the total of 242 participants in the initial study. We administered a structured questionnaire to obtain basic information about the current clinical situation of patients and occurrences of subsequent pregnancy and presence of hypertensive disorders during pregnancy. We also searched for information on the use of hypotensive drugs and contraceptives. The following characteristics were checked and recorded: a) current weight, b) blood pressure c) body mass index - BMI, and we collected biological samples (blood and urine) for measurement of biochemical parameters and evaluation of microalbuminúria. Finally, we monitored the ambulatory blood pressure (ABP), which uses the method of automatic measurement of heart rate, systolic and diastolic blood pressure and an average of the two for the period of 24 hours. RESULTS: Out of 218 women who completed the study, the incidence of hypertensive disorders was of 16.9% (37 out of 218), while the incidence of preeclampsia was 13.8% (30 of 218). Women with preeclampsia had a BMI (body mass index) averaged of 25.3 (± 4.8) while this ratio in normotensive women was of 23.5 (± 3.7), p = 0.02. The risk of preeclampsia rises with age (OR 1084 p = 0.0034) and with a family history of hypertension (OR 2.6 p = 0.01). The follow-up one year after delivery revealed that 50% of women with hypertensive disorders in pregnancy remained hypertensive. High BMI was also observed after 5 years of delivery. CONCLUSIONS: an elevated BMI, age above 35 years and excessive weight gain during pregnancy were associated with hypertension in the long term in patients with prior preeclampsia. History of preeclampsia increases the risk of chronic hypertension
